Why a Specialized Resume is Crucial for Endoscopy Nurses

The field of endoscopy is highly specialized, demanding a unique skillset and a deep understanding of patient care, procedural protocols, and equipment operation. A generic nursing resume simply won't cut it. Hiring managers need to quickly assess your proficiency in areas like sterile technique, patient monitoring during procedures, and emergency response. Your resume is your first impression – make it count by highlighting these critical aspects.

2. Resume Summary/Objective: Your Elevator Pitch

This is your chance to immediately grab the reader's attention. A resume summary is best for experienced nurses, highlighting your key accomplishments and skills. An objective is more suitable for entry-level candidates or those changing careers, stating your career goals.

Example Summary (Experienced): "Highly skilled and compassionate Endoscopy Nurse with 8+ years of experience providing exceptional patient care during diagnostic and therapeutic endoscopic procedures. Proven ability to maintain sterile technique, monitor patient vital signs, and respond effectively to emergencies. Expertise in GI, pulmonology, and urology endoscopy. Seeking a challenging role at [Hospital Name] to leverage my skills and contribute to a high-quality patient experience."

Example Objective (Entry-Level): "Dedicated and detail-oriented recent nursing graduate seeking an Endoscopy Nurse position at [Hospital Name]. Eager to apply my foundational knowledge of patient care, sterile procedures, and medical terminology to contribute to a safe and efficient endoscopy unit. Committed to continuous learning and professional development."

3. Skills: The Keyword Powerhouse

This section is critical for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S). ATS are used by many hospitals to filter resumes based on keywords. Include both hard skills (technical abilities) and soft skills (personal attributes).

Pro Tip: Review job descriptions for endoscopy nurse job description resume positions you're interested in and incorporate relevant keywords into your skills section.

4. Experience: Showcasing Your Expertise

This is the heart of your resume.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to describe your accomplishments. Quantify your achievements whenever possible.

Example:

Position: Endoscopy Nurse
Hospital: St. Luke's Medical Center
Dates of Employment: 2018 – Present
Responsibilities/Achievements:
  • Assisted physicians with over 500 endoscopic procedures annually, including colonoscopies, gastroscopies, and EGDs.
  • Maintained a 100% compliance rate with sterile technique protocols, ensuring patient safety.
  • Proactively identified and addressed potential patient complications, resulting in a 15% reduction in post-procedure adverse events.
  • Trained and mentored new nursing staff on endoscopy procedures and equipment operation.
  • Proficiently utilized Epic EMR system for accurate and timely documentation.
